Commercial Capital Company, a provider of capital equipment financing for businesses and equipment vendors, is pleased to announce the addition of two new team members as the company continues to scale its operations: Dan Rhodes as Capital Markets Manager and Madison Graniewski as Credit Analyst.
Commercial Capital Welcomes Dan Rhodes, Capital Markets Manager
Rhodes brings more than 15 years of experience in syndications, loan servicing, and asset management, along with a strong background in building efficient, scalable financial operations.
Before joining Commercial Capital Company, Rhodes served as Vice President of Commercial Loan Operations at Busey Bank, where he led initiatives to improve operational efficiency, streamline internal workflows, and implement systems that increased accuracy, consistency, and scalability across the organization.

Commercial Capital Welcomes Madison Graniewski, Credit Analyst
Madison Graniewski brings more than five years of underwriting experience and a strong background in credit analysis and risk assessment within the equipment finance industry.
Prior to joining Commercial Capital Company, she spent over three years as a Credit Analyst at MHC Financial Services, where she reviewed customer credit, assessed risk, and supported sound lending decisions. Her experience includes creating and reviewing customer contracts, analyzing repossessions, extensions, and refinances, and reviewing financial statements to evaluate customers’ financial strength. She also brings valuable knowledge of the trucking industry, further strengthening the credit team.
